Ng3m(Bo), Antigen, Antiserum, Control
Immunology
The Ng3m(Bo) Antigen, Antiserum, and Control is an immunological reagent used to detect and characterize the Ng3m(bo) allotypic determinant on immunoglobulin molecules, with applications in immunogenetic studies and specialized clinical testing. It is classified as FDA Class 1, the lowest risk category, subject only to general controls and exempt from premarket notification. The device is regulated under 21 CFR 866.5065 within the Immunology specialty.
